LIVE UNITED Awards were presented to three outstanding volunteers at an after-work ceremony on April 22, 2010, who not only understand what it means to Live United, but demonstrate it every day.
The nominees for the United Way of the Midlands LIVE UNITED Volunteer Awards are volunteers (group or individual) that have dedicated themselves to service throughout the year and helped promote the spirit of volunteerism in the community through service to the United Way of the Midlands. Each of the winners contributed to the community in a different capacity, but all were selected for the tremendous dedication and assistance in advancing United Way of the Midlands' mission of improving lives by making lasting changes.
2009 LIVE UNITED Award Winners:
Stacey Atkinson currently serves on the UWM Community Impact Council and Public Policy Council. Atkinson’s extensive involvement with Women in Philanthropy since 2003 has led to the improvement of the organization’s structure and an increase in WIP’s impact on the community. Her dedication to improving the lives of at-risk youth is demonstrated by her work for over 30 years in Juvenile Justice and Juvenile Corrections.

The Criteria for the LIVE UNITED Volunteer Awards are as follows:
The nominee must have volunteered for United Way of the Midlands, may not be a winner in any other category, and the nominee's volunteer hours must have been served in 2009.
